Factors Influencing Costs
Building raising is a process used to elevate structures in Monmouth, IL, often to protect against flooding or to prepare for foundation work. This procedure involves carefully lifting a building to a new, higher elevation using specialized equipment. The scope and complexity of building raising projects can vary based on the structure's size, materials, and local permitting requirements.
- Materials: Typically involves wood, concrete, and steel components to support the structure during and after the lift.
- Size and Scope: Ranges from small residential buildings to larger commercial structures, with scope depending on height and foundation type.
- Labor Complexity: Requires skilled labor for precise lifting, stabilization, and alignment to ensure structural integrity.
- Permitting: Usually involves local building permits and adherence to Monmouth, IL, zoning and safety regulations.
- Extras: May include foundation repairs, utility disconnections and reconnections, and additional stabilization measures.
